For the SH Monsterarts 54 godzilla: I would wait. They have been reprinting figures lately, and they have also been repainting the figures and doing rereleases. 54 Godzilla is probably due for a re-issue. Also next year is going to be the 70th anniversary. They might just release a brand new sculpt, who knows?
Either way I would not recommend paying scalper prices. The figure’s eyes are also a little bit wonky, and SH Monsterarts is not reliable at all for painting on eyes correctly. You don’t want to roll the dice with a scalped figure on that. As for the size, Bandai made up some BS about Showa era figures needing to be smaller.
